Course Details
• Car Cybersecurity Fundamentals: Exploring the basics of car cybersecurity, including common threats and vulnerabilities, security measures, and the importance of cybersecurity in the automotive industry.
• Vehicle Network Protocols: Examining the various network protocols used in modern vehicles, such as CAN, LIN, and FlexRay, and their associated security risks and mitigations.
• Cryptography for Car Cybersecurity: Delving into the role of cryptography in car cybersecurity, including encryption, digital signatures, and authentication methods.
• Secure Vehicle Software Development: Best practices for secure software development for automotive applications, including secure coding techniques and code reviews.
• Intrusion Detection and Prevention: Techniques for detecting and preventing cyber attacks on vehicles, including network monitoring, anomaly detection, and security event logging.
• Physical Security for Automotive Systems: Understanding the importance of physical security for automotive systems, including hardware tamper-resistance and secure key management.
• Car Cybersecurity Standards and Regulations: Overview of the current and emerging standards and regulations for car cybersecurity, including ISO/SAE 21434 and UNECE WP.29.
• Penetration Testing and Vulnerability Assessments: Techniques for identifying and addressing vulnerabilities in automotive systems, including penetration testing, fuzz testing, and vulnerability scanning.
• Incident Response and Recovery: Best practices for responding to and recovering from car cybersecurity incidents, including incident response planning, communication, and post-incident analysis.
